Special situations
There are several special defibrillation scenarios:
- in the rare circumstance where a child must be defibrillated the energy is 2 Joules per kilo, or 1 Joule per pound.
- in patients with internal pacemakers the paddles should be at least 12 cm - 5 inches - from the box. External pacemakers should be disconnected.
